Naureen Anwar

CEO at NameShouts

Naureen Anwar has a diverse work experience spanning from 2008 to present. Naureen currently serves as the CEO of NameShouts, a name pronunciation tool that helps organizations provide personalized service to diverse customers. Prior to this, Naureen founded Jukti Initiative, a non-profit telemedicine initiative aiming to provide quality medical care to rural areas in Bangladesh through technology. Naureen also worked as a Software Developer at SAP Labs from 2011 to 2015. Naureen's work history includes roles as a participant at startup weekend, a Project Coordinator at Nakisa, and an Intern at Nortel.

Naureen Anwar attended McGill University from 2005 to 2010, where they completed a Bachelor of Engineering (BEng) in the Electrical Engineering Internship Program.
